Read the short little article here by Fraendy Clervaud about the proposed All-White Basketball League set to begin soon:
Augusta, GA—This is not the type of news that Augusta Mayor Deke Copenhaver wanted to hear the day after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. Day.
Mayor Deke Copenhaver: “I am a sports enthusiast, myself, but I just don’t think that idea is going to fly in Augusta, Georgia.”
It’s the idea of an all white professional basketball league. According to a press release from the All- American Basketball Alliance, the group is looking to target southern cities such as Augusta, Albany and Chattanooga, Tennessee to form a team.
Mayor Copenhaver: “We have done to much to really foster a spirit of inclusiveness in this city.”
The press release goes on to say that only natural born United States citizens and players, whose parents are both Caucasian, can join the league.
Dip Metress, ASU Head Men’s Basketball Coach: “Nobody is going to put money behind this. Basketball is an international game. We have three, four international players here and coaches international.”
Don “Moose” Lewis is the league commissioner and says that “white basketball players” are essentially shutout of conventional professional basketball due to the growth of non-organized play on the court. This statement is not sitting well with Metress.
Metress: “The game has changed throughout the years. In a sense, it’s more athletic games, but the fundamentals are not eroding.”
Lewis also states players on professional teams are carrying guns, attacking fans, and fundamentally sound white players are a vanishing species.
Mayor Copenhaver: “You still see lots of players who are fundamentally sound that basketball is played in a bunch of different fashions. You have five different positions. You have a point guard who distributes the ball, so I think basketball is basketball.”
